I bought my 4th gen Lude.
Just wanted to share a few memories with those who will appreciate them most.
I'd been looking for a clean, low mileage 4th gen for around 12 months and just missed out on a black JDM around a month previously. Then I saw 'my lude', a 96 4th gen 2.2vtec UKDM. I was at the dealers at Wokingham at 7:30 waiting for him to open up. The car was mint. Stock silver 4th gen with full leather interior and only 31k on the clock with FSH. I bought it, returning at the weekend to drive it away.
Driving home I felt like I was driving an ultra super car! Looking at the wing in the rear view mirror and the wonderfully sculpted side rear windows through the wing mirrors. Not to mention that unique digital dash. I felt so proud and thrilled to be driving such a great car I'd wanted for so long to own.
Little did I know then how precious and special it was to become to me. In the background of photos at family occasions, visits to the beach or weekends away. I even put a white ribbon on it the day before my wedding, my mates asking who I was going to marry, my wife or the car!
I've invested as much into the car as I would have done spending to buy a newer model; typically rear arch and sunroof rust repairs; brakes, discs, pads etc. However, I've not regretted spending a single penny.
Today, driving to work it was special, in the summer rain!!!, remembering when I bought it and how it has been apart of so many key events in my life over the past ten years. A moment of happy reflection.
